As pet owners, we all want to make sure our furry friends are happy and healthy. One way to achieve this is by making mealtime more fun and enjoyable for them. Here are some tips on how to make mealtime more fun for your furry friend:
1. Play with Their Food:
Playing with your pet’s food may sound counterintuitive to teaching good behavior, but this tactic can actually be helpful if your pet struggles with anxiety or boredom during mealtime. You can start by placing your pet’s food in different areas of the room or hiding the food under toys or treats. This will help stimulate their senses and encourage them to explore their environment while they eat.
2. Use Puzzle Feeders:
Puzzle feeders are a great way to make mealtime more fun for your furry friend. These toys require your pet to work for their food, stimulating their mind and keeping them occupied while they eat. Puzzle feeders come in a variety of shapes and sizes, so make sure to choose one that is appropriate for your pet’s size and level of difficulty. These feeders are available at most pet stores or online and will keep your pet entertained for hours.
